A specialized tuber, employed for propagation, serves as the starting point for cultivating new potato plants. Unlike true botanical seeds that result from sexual reproduction, these tubers are vegetatively propagated, ensuring genetic consistency with the parent plant. A segment of a larger tuber, or a small whole tuber specifically grown for this purpose, can be planted to produce an entirely new plant.
Utilizing certified disease-free tubers is critical for ensuring healthy crops and maximizing yields. Selecting high-quality planting material minimizes the risk of introducing pathogens into the field, safeguarding the developing plants from debilitating illnesses. Historically, farmers often saved tubers from previous harvests; however, the practice of employing certified stock has become increasingly prevalent due to its positive impact on crop health and overall productivity.

In the context of Power Automate, the terms “body,” “value,” “key,” “item,” and “output” refer to distinct components involved in data manipulation within a flow. “Body” generally pertains to the complete data structure received from an action, often in JSON format. “Value” represents a specific data point extracted from this body. “Key” is the identifier used to locate a particular value within the data structure. “Item” is frequently used when dealing with arrays or collections of data, representing a single element within that collection. Finally, “Output” signifies the result generated by a specific action or connector within the flow. As an example, consider a scenario where a flow receives JSON data containing customer information. The entire JSON payload is considered the “body.” Extracting the customer’s “email address” would involve identifying the “key” associated with email and retrieving its corresponding “value” from the “body.” If the customer had multiple addresses stored in an array, each address would be considered an “item.” The final set of processed customer data would be the “output” of that part of the flow.
Understanding these concepts is fundamental to effectively designing and troubleshooting Power Automate flows. It enables users to accurately parse data, extract relevant information, and manipulate it as needed. This understanding allows for the creation of more robust and dynamic automated processes. This alphanumeric marking, frequently found on jewelry, denotes the metal composition of the item. Specifically, it indicates that the piece is crafted from sterling silver. The ‘S’ likely stands for ‘Silver’. The numerical portion, ‘925,’ signifies that the metal contains 92.5% pure silver. The remaining 7.5% is typically composed of other metals, such as copper, which are added to enhance the material’s durability and workability. For example, a ring bearing this stamp confirms it is made of sterling silver alloy.
Understanding this marking is crucial for consumers because it provides assurance regarding the silver content and value of the item. Pure silver is often too soft for practical use in jewelry; therefore, alloying it with other metals is necessary. The presence of the marking indicates that the jewelry meets a recognized standard for silver content. Historically, sterling silver has been a popular choice for jewelry and silverware due to its appealing luster and relative affordability compared to purer forms of precious metals.

Professional boxers typically employ gloves weighing either 8 ounces or 10 ounces during competition. These gloves are an essential piece of equipment, designed to protect the hands of the boxer and, to a lesser extent, the opponent. For example, in lighter weight divisions, such as flyweight or bantamweight, fighters generally use 8-ounce gloves. As the weight classes increase, for example, in the welterweight or middleweight divisions, 10-ounce gloves are standard.
The selection of glove weight is crucial for both safety and competitive strategy. Lighter gloves permit faster hand speed and can potentially increase the frequency of punches landed. Heavier gloves offer enhanced protection, mitigating the risk of hand injuries for the boxer. Historically, the use of gloves in boxing evolved from bare-knuckle fighting to provide a degree of safety and to standardize the sport. Regulatory bodies like athletic commissions often mandate the specific glove weight to be used in a particular fight, ensuring fair play and reasonable safety standards are observed.
